{Backlink Tactics That Truly Work (and Which Don't )

Acquiring authoritative backlinks remains a essential component of the successful SEO campaign . However, the landscape has shifted, rendering some older backlink techniques obsolete. Abandon risky practices like purchased link schemes and manipulative article distribution; search engines continue to punish such aggressively . Instead, concentrate on natural relationship creation with established online resources in your field. Here's a brief rundown:

  • Contributed articles on quality sites.
  • Developing shareable content , like data visualizations or insightful studies .
  • Missing link building – identifying broken links on respected domains and offering your resource as a replacement .
  • Actively in niche discussions and sharing helpful information .

Keep in mind that backlink acquisition is a long-term game; prioritize relevance over number.

Analyzing Your Backlink Profile: What to Look For

Understanding the backlink link structure is critical for determining the website’s authority and search engine ranking. A complete review involves examining several key aspects. First, look for the quantity of backlinks - a substantial number isn’t always beneficial; quality trumps volume. Next, assess the DA of the referring websites. Links from high-authority sites carry far more importance than those from poor ones. Moreover, examine the text used – a natural mix is preferred; avoid too much precise keywords. Finally, watch out for harmful backlinks, which can negatively impact your page’s position and must be removed.

  • Amount of backlinks
  • Domain strength of referring sites
  • Anchor text diversity
  • Harmful backlinks

Addressing Toxic Backlinks: A Simple Step-by-Step Manual

Toxic backlinks will seriously damage your website's position in search engine pages . Fortunately , you can take steps to fix them . Here's a practical guide to tackling the issue:


  • Locate Toxic Backlinks: Use tools like Ahrefs to discover backlinks pointing to your site. Focus on low-quality websites, off-topic content, and sites with questionable reputations.
  • Assess the Impact of Each Link: Focus on the most damaging backlinks initially . Consider things including the domain rating and the number of other toxic links referencing the same domain .
  • Implement a Removal Strategy: The ideal approach is often to reject the backlinks through Google's Removal Process. Make certain to meticulously check the list when submitting it. Direct contact with the domain holder for taking down is a possible approach but might be less consistent .
  • Track Results: After you reject backlinks, it is crucial to keep an eye on your website’s search rankings and un-paid visitors to ensure the problem is corrected.

Don't forget that resolving toxic backlinks is an ongoing process and demands frequent monitoring .
